What Types of Facilities and Work Can Certified Radiology Technologist Professionals Expect in Arizona?

At AMN Healthcare, we recognize the vital role Certified Radiology Technologists play in the healthcare landscape of Arizona, where diverse opportunities await in various facilities. In this sun-soaked state, professionals can find rewarding positions in cutting-edge hospitals, bustling outpatient clinics, specialized imaging centers, and even remote rural healthcare facilities, ensuring access to essential radiologic services. With a strong demand for skilled radiology technologists, candidates can expect to engage in a range of responsibilities, including performing diagnostic imaging procedures such as X-rays, MRIs, and CT scans, collaborating closely with physicians to ensure accurate diagnoses, and leveraging advanced technology to provide exceptional patient care. This temporary direct CT Technologist/Radiologic Technologist opportunity is located in Chinle, Arizona, in the heart of the Navajo Nation. Chinle offers a truly unique professional and personal experience, combining advanced medical imaging practice with the chance to live and work in an area known for its natural beauty and rich cultural traditions. Chinle is best known as the gateway to Canyon de Chelly National Monument, where dramatic red rock canyons, towering sandstone walls, and ancient cliff dwellings create some of the most memorable scenery in the Southwest.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y hiking, photography, and guided tours that highlight both the landscape and the deep cultural significance of the area. The region provides a peaceful, small-town environment with a strong sense of community, making it ideal for those who value a quieter lifestyle, star-filled night skies, and close connections with the patients they serve. This role is a temp direct assignment for 4 CT Tech/Rad Tech positions, supporting a government-affiliated hospital that serves Navajo and American Indian/Alaska Native patients. The facility is equipped with modern imaging technology, including a GE Revolution Evo CT scanner, Shimadzu X-ray systems, GE Portable X-ray, GE Precision Fluoroscopy, and C-arm capabilities. Technologists here have the opportunity to work with up-to-date equipment in a setting where their skills have a direct, meaningful impact on a community that often faces limited access to specialty care. Assignment length is 26 to 52 weeks, with an ASAP start and an anticipated onboarding period of approximately 6–8 weeks. The schedule follows a 7 days on / 7 days off rotation with 12-hour shifts: Day Shift: 8:00 AM – 8:00 PM, including weekends and holidays Night Shift: 8:00 PM – 8:00 AM, including weekends and holidays This pattern allows for extended stretches of time off, which can be used to explore the surrounding region, travel, or simply rest and recharge. On-call coverage is possible and will be scheduled as needed by the department. As a dual-modality role, you will provide both CT and general radiography/fluoroscopy services. A typical day may include performing CT scans on the GE Revolution Evo CT, completing standard and specialized radiographic exams, and supporting fluoroscopic procedures for radiologists and providers. You will be expected to: Perform a broad range of diagnostic radiographic studies, including extremities, spine, chest, abdomen, and complex fluoroscopic procedures such as IVPs, barium swallows, cystograms, and GI series Assist in the operating room with C-arm guidance for orthopedic, trauma, and other surgical procedures Conduct CT examinations across a variety of patient populations and indications, including emergency, inpatient, and outpatient studies Insert IV lines for contrast administration, monitor patients for reactions, and recognize and respond appropriately to injection-related complications Coordinate imaging workflow with radiologists, emergency medicine teams, surgeons, and other clinicians Adhere to ALARA principles and ensure proper radiation safety for patients, staff, and self Provide compassionate, culturally sensitive care, often working closely with interpreters and family members when patients primarily speak Navajo Maintain accurate documentation in the facility’s EMR and PACS systems Patient volumes may fluctuate, but technologists can expect a mix of scheduled outpatient exams, inpatient imaging, and emergent/urgent studies from the emergency department. The environment offers significant variety in case types, including trauma, chronic disease management, and preventive care, providing a strong platform for skill development and resume-building experience. The facility fosters a collaborative atmosphere where technologists are valued members of the care team. You will work closely with radiologists, nurses, and providers who appreciate the critical role imaging plays in diagnosis and treatment. The government-affiliated setting provides a structured, protocol-driven environment that supports quality and consistency in patient care. This position is particularly well suited for technologists seeking: Meaningful work serving an underserved community Experience with dual-modality practice in CT and general radiography/fluoroscopy Exposure to a wide variety of case types, including emergency and trauma imaging The chance to live in a scenic region with distinctive cultural experiences and a slower-paced lifestyle A 7-on/7-off schedule that offers extended time off for travel and exploration

What types of experience are most commonly required for a Travel Certified Radiology Technologist job in Arizona?

Most travel Certified Radiology Technologist positions in Arizona typically require experience in performing a variety of imaging procedures, including X-rays, CT scans, and MRIs. Additionally, candidates often need to demonstrate proficiency in utilizing radiologic equipment and must hold relevant certifications and licenses specific to the state.

What types of job opportunities are typically available for Certified Radiology Technologist Travel positions in Arizona?

Certified Radiology Technologist opportunities in Arizona encompass Travel positions. These roles offer adaptable work arrangements, allowing professionals to choose options that align with their career goals, lifestyle, and level of experience.

What types of healthcare facilities in Arizona typically offer Travel positions for Certified Radiology Technologist professionals?

In Arizona, travel positions for Certified Radiology Technologist professionals are commonly found in hospitals, including large medical centers and smaller community hospitals, as well as outpatient imaging centers. Additionally, some specialty clinics and urgent care facilities may also provide opportunities for temporary positions in this field.

What types of specialties are common for a Certified Radiology Technologist professional working a Travel job in Arizona?

Certified Radiology Technologists traveling in Arizona often specialize in areas such as diagnostic imaging, MRI, and CT scans due to the high demand for these services in various healthcare facilities across the state. Some may also focus on ultrasound technology, which is valuable given the prevalence of maternity and pediatric care in the region. Additionally, specialties in interventional radiology and mammography may be sought after as healthcare providers adapt to the needs of diverse patient populations. Overall, the ability to work across multiple imaging modalities can enhance job opportunities and flexibility in such travel positions.
